About Heng Pan
Heng Pan is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Biomedical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Automotive Engineering and Mechanical Engineering, having authored 101 papers that have together received 3.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nanomaterials and Printing Technologies (19 papers),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(14 papers), Additive Manufacturing and 3D Printing Technologies (13 papers), Nonlinear Optical Materials Studies (10 papers), Advancements in Battery Materials (10 papers), Advanced Battery Technologies Research (9 papers), Laser-Ablation Synthesis of Nanoparticles (9 papers) and nanoparticles nucleation surface interactions (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Automotive Engineering (809 citations), Biomedical Engineering (1.8k cit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(2.4k citations), Polymers and Plastics (452 citations) and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(449 citations). Heng Pan has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Costas P. Grigoropoulos, Seung Hwan Ko, Jean M. J. Fréchet, Dimos Poulikakos, Christine K. Luscombe, Wan Shou, Brandon Ludwig, Xiaowei Yu, Yan Wang and Inkyu Park.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Physics Letters, Applied Physics A, Advanced Materials, Journal of Manufacturing Science and Engineering and Small.
